Bulgaria’s Embassy in London to host career forum on March 7

Photo: bulgarianembassy-london.org

Bulgaria’s Ministry of Labor and Social Policy and the National Employment Agency are organizing on March 7 a Career Forum at the Bulgarian Embassy in London. The event is part of the initiative to encourage and attract Bulgarian citizens living and working abroad to make a career in Bulgaria. During the Career Forum in London, Bulgarian students and young professionals will be acquainted with the career opportunities in their home country. They will have the opportunity to meet directly with companies and employers from different sectors of the economy and the industry. According to data of the British authorities, there are over 6,000 Bulgarian students in the United Kingdom in over 50 fields of studies.
